Google Search Console

📊 SEO 搜索数据一站式分析

Developer Tools榜 #14

Google Search Console 数据查询工具,支持搜索分析、索引状态检查、CTR 机会挖掘等 SEO 核心场景,需 OAuth 授权

收藏
15.1k
安装
6k
版本
1.1.0
CLS 安全性认证2026-05-13
点击查看完整报告 >

使用说明

核心用法

Google Search Console Skill 是一款面向 SEO 专业人员的命令行数据分析工具,通过调用 Google Search Console API 获取搜索表现数据。用户需配置 OAuth 凭据(与 GA4 共享)并确保账户具有目标站点的 Search Console 访问权限。

主要功能模块包括:

  • 站点管理:列出可访问的 Search Console 属性
  • 搜索查询分析:获取带来流量的关键词及其点击、展示、CTR、排名数据
  • 页面表现追踪:识别高流量页面与低效页面
  • CTR 机会挖掘:筛选高展示低点击的优化机会
  • URL 索引检查:验证特定页面是否被 Google 收录
  • 站点地图监控:检查 sitemap 提交状态

数据支持多维度切片(query/page/country/device/date),默认存在约 3 天的数据延迟。

显著优点

1. 官方数据源:直接对接 Google Search Console,数据权威性与 GA4 同级
2. SEO 场景闭环:覆盖从关键词研究、内容优化到技术 SEO 的完整工作流

3. 机会识别自动化:内置低 CTR 检测逻辑,快速定位标题/描述优化点

4. 凭证复用:与 GA4 skill 共享 OAuth 配置,降低多工具维护成本

潜在局限

  • 数据延迟:搜索分析数据约有 3 天滞后,无法用于实时决策
  • 权限依赖:必须拥有目标站点的 Search Console 访问权,无法跨账户抓取竞品数据
  • URL 检查限制:inspect-url 功能仅支持已存在于属性中的页面
  • 无可视化输出:纯命令行/JSON 格式,需配合其他工具做图表分析

适合人群

  • SEO 专员与内容运营:日常监控搜索表现、挖掘关键词机会
  • 网站管理员:排查索引问题、验证站点地图健康度
  • 增长团队:结合 GA4 skill 做搜索流量归因分析

常规风险

  • OAuth 凭据泄露.env 文件存储敏感凭证,需确保文件权限与版本控制隔离
  • 数据权限边界:工具本身仅读取数据,但错误配置 scope 可能扩大授权范围
  • API 配额消耗:频繁查询大型站点可能触及 Google API 速率限制
  • 隐私合规:搜索查询数据可能包含用户敏感信息,需遵循 GDPR 等数据保护法规

安全解读

核心用法

gsc 是一个用于查询 Google Search Console 数据的命令行工具,帮助用户分析搜索表现、发现优化机会并监控索引状态。该 Skill 通过 Python 脚本调用 Google 官方 API,支持多种查询模式:

  • 站点列表:查看账户下可访问的所有 Search Console 属性
  • 热门查询/页面:获取指定时间段内的搜索查询词或着陆页排名
  • 低 CTR 机会挖掘:识别高曝光但低点击率的页面,指导标题和描述优化
  • URL 索引检查:实时查询特定页面的收录状态和覆盖情况
  • 站点地图管理:列出已提交的 sitemap 及其状态

所有命令均需先加载 OAuth 凭证环境变量,支持多维度分析(query/page/country/device/date),返回 clicks、impressions、ctr、position 等核心 SEO 指标。

显著优点

1. 官方 API 保障:使用 Google 官方认证的 Python 客户端库(google-api-python-client),数据来源权威可靠,非第三方爬虫模拟
2. 数据维度丰富:支持 5 种分析维度和 4 项关键指标,满足从技术 SEO 到内容策略的多元需求

3. 精准优化导向:"opportunities" 命令专设低 CTR 检测逻辑,直接指向可执行的 SEO 改进点

4. 权限最小化:仅申请 webmasters.readonly 只读权限,遵循 OAuth 最小权限原则

5. 与 GA4 共享凭证:复用现有 Google Analytics 4 的 OAuth 配置,降低部署复杂度

潜在缺点与局限性

  • 数据延迟:GSC 数据存在约 3 天的统计延迟,无法用于实时决策
  • 采样限制:大型站点在查询详细维度组合时可能遇到数据采样,影响极端长尾分析的准确性
  • 索引状态局限:URL Inspection 仅支持已收录或已知 URL,无法主动提交新 URL 收录请求
  • 技术门槛:需要手动配置 OAuth 2.0 凭证、处理环境变量,对非技术用户不够友好
  • 无历史对比:当前版本未内置多期数据对比功能,需手动导出处理

适合人群

  • SEO 专员与分析师:需要深度挖掘搜索表现数据、定位优化机会
  • 内容运营团队:追踪关键词表现,验证内容策略效果
  • 技术 SEO 工程师:批量检查索引状态、监控站点地图健康度
  • 数据驱动型站长:习惯命令行工具、需要自动化报告流程的中小站点管理者

常规风险

  • 凭证管理:OAuth 凭证存储于本地 .env 文件,若权限设置不当(非 600)或误提交至版本控制,存在泄露风险
  • Token 失效:Refresh token 可能因账户变更或权限撤销而失效,需重新认证流程
  • API 配额:Google API 存在调用配额限制,高频自动化查询需规划请求频率
  • 数据解读误区:CTR 和排名位置数据为平均值,直接用于绝对排名判断可能产生偏差

Google Search Console 内容

scripts文件夹
手动下载zip · 6.0 kB
gsc_auth.pytext/plain
请选择文件